Soil chemistry data in Table 1 illustrates the soil characteristics correlated from the TIC project with the <br /> subject project,and was used to arrive at a reasonable denitrification factor. As noted,the denitrification <br /> factor of 60% is 33% lower than if I used 90%denitrification. A denitrification factor of 54%could have <br /> been used and still remained under the Nitrate Loading Standards. There are other projects that I have been <br /> involved with that illustrate similar denitrification percentages based upon the soil chemistry and texture <br /> analyses obtained. In addition,I did witness the installation of the septic tank that serves the existing <br /> modular home on the subject property and observed that the soil is of consistent characteristics to an <br /> approximate depth of eight ft. <br /> It should be noted that in the last five years, several arbitrary and capricious changes and misinterpretations <br /> were made to the nitrate loading equation factors and procedures by an outside consultant retained by the <br /> EHD and by the former Unit 1I Program Manager. These include arbitrarily changing the wastewater flow <br /> volumes emanating from single family residential structures, lack of understanding and misinterpretation of <br /> evapotranspiration/evaporation concepts,misunderstanding stormwater flow volume calculations, <br /> incorporating additional area into a well-defined subject property area, etc. <br /> Although an applicant's consultant is under no obligation to use the Hantzsche-Finnemore equation, it is <br /> used extensively for nitrate loading calculations. However, it must be understood that the equation has no <br /> less than a dozen variables and/or unknowns associated with it. <br /> Consequently, it is my opinion that a consulting civil engineer on a nitrate loading project should have the <br /> ability to make determinations such as denitrification factors, based upon their experience,knowledge, <br /> expertise and chemistry test results.
